The Growing Popularity of Decentralized Finance (DeFi)
DeFi has increasingly become a buzzword in the cryptocurrency space. This movement focuses on building decentralized financial systems that do not rely on traditional financial intermediaries like banks.
Major Components of DeFi
- Lending Platforms: Decentralized lending solutions allow users to borrow and lend cryptocurrencies without traditional banks.
- Decentralized Exchanges (DEXes): These platforms allow users to trade cryptocurrencies directly with each other, enhancing privacy and reducing fees.
- Yield Farming: Investors can earn returns by providing liquidity to DeFi protocols.
Implications for the Future
- Accessibility: DeFi systems can provide financial services to unbanked populations, expanding access to finance.
- New Opportunities: With innovative products emerging, investors can find diverse opportunities within the DeFi sector.
- Risks: Smart contract vulnerabilities and market risks persist, making thorough research critical.
Bitcoin’s Continued Dominance
Bitcoin remains the pioneering cryptocurrency and continues to dominate the market. However, 2023 has shown a shift in how Bitcoin is viewed—as both a store of value and an inflation hedge, especially amid global economic uncertainties.
Key Factors Influencing Bitcoin in 2023
- Institutional Adoption: Major companies are adding Bitcoin to their balance sheets, further embedding it into traditional finance.
- Halving Event: The upcoming Bitcoin halving in 2024 is leading to bullish sentiment among investors in 2023, as historically, Bitcoin has seen price increases following halving events.

Security and Privacy Concerns
As cryptocurrency adoption increases, so do the risks associated with hacking and fraud. Security breaches can lead to significant losses for both individuals and institutions.
Best Practices for Cryptocurrency Security
- Use Hardware Wallets: Store your cryptocurrencies in a hardware wallet for added security.
- Enable Two-Factor Authentication (2FA): This can provide an extra layer of security for your accounts.
- Stay Informed: Regularly follow security news and updates in the crypto space.
